About 133 Mail Rte

Rustic Log Home Retreat on 5.08 Acres of Natural Beauty Welcome to 133 Mail Route Road, a rare opportunity to own a one-of-a-kind log home nestled on 5.08 private wooded acres just outside of Reading, PA. Built in 1979, this warm and inviting property blends rustic charm with timeless craftsmanship, offering the perfect setting for those seeking peace, privacy, and the tranquility of nature. This 3 to 4 bedroom home with a loft features 2 full bathrooms, generous living spaces, and beautiful views in every direction. From the exposed log walls to the glowing hardwood floors, this home is a true retreat that celebrates its natural surroundings. A Great Room That Lives Up to Its Name Step inside and immediately feel the grandeur of the dramatic Great Room with its cathedral ceiling, skylights, and a stunning floor-to-ceiling stone fireplace—the perfect gathering spot for cozy evenings or entertaining guests. Natural light filters in from above, highlighting the craftsmanship of the exposed beams and log walls that carry throughout the main and upper levels. Comfortable Living With Rustic Style The layout offers flexibility with 3 to 4 spacious bedrooms, each featuring gorgeous log walls and rich wood flooring. A cozy loft area provides the perfect space for reading, working, or relaxing while taking in views of the Great Room below. Just off the main living space, a 3-season sunroom invites you to enjoy the serenity of the outdoors in comfort—whether you're sipping your morning coffee or unwinding at the end of the day. Versatile Lower Level Living The walk-out lower level includes a large family room with a coal stove, offering an additional cozy living area. A full bath and laundry area make this space ideal for guests or extended family living. With ample natural light and access to the outdoors, this level adds to the home's livability and versatility. Outdoor Living & Entertaining Relax on the expansive full-length front porch, the ideal place to enjoy the peaceful sounds of the surrounding woods. The 5.08-acre lot offers plenty of space for gardens, fruit trees, and play areas, making it a dream setting for nature lovers, families, or anyone looking to escape the hustle and bustle of everyday life. A built-in 2-car garage and off-street parking for 15+ vehicles offer room for all your toys, tools, and guests.

Reading, PA housing market in March 2025 saw over 54 listings sold above listed price, more than 34 sold at listed price and over 43 sold below. In March 2025 in Reading, PA there were 23.2% more homes for sale than in February. Listings spent 31 days on the market in March 2025, and had a median list price of $251,943 during the same period.
